What you’ll learn

You’ll be gaining a broad overview of knowledge required to be an exemplary business leader, including global strategy and economics, strategic marketing, people management and leadership, innovation, business analytics and corporate responsibility and sustainability. You will end your Master's with a series of four challenges including personal development, a consultancy project, an international business challenge, a business start-up task and write an independent research project under the supervision of a expert supervisor.

Professional recognition

The MBA programme is accredited by The Association of MBAs (AMBA), the international impartial authority on postgraduate business education. An accreditation with AMBA is a global standard for MBA programmes worldwide.

In addition, the MBA is accredited by the Chartered Management Institute (CMI), giving you the opportunity to gain, alongside your MBA, the CMI Level 7 Diploma in Strategic Management & Leadership on the successful completion of your studies. The CMI is committed to excellence in management and leadership and the CMI qualification is highly sought after by employers.

Chevening scholarships

This programme attracts many applications from Chevening scholars. Chevening is the UK Government’s international awards scheme aimed at developing global leaders, and Kent is a Chevening partner.
